
According to the portal DEBKAfile, the secret services said that Iranian specialists would control the S-300 anti-aircraft missile systems delivered to Russia by Syria. An Israeli resource specializing in military intelligence writes that Moscow allegedly initially planned to entrust the Iranian specialists with managing the Syrian air defense systems. The United States and Israel accused Russia of “deceiving” the S-300.
The portal writes that Russia delivered to Syria complexes of the same modification S-300PMU-2, which Iran received from Russia in 2016. In addition, Israeli propaganda accused Moscow of allegedly transferring Iranian operators to Syria.
The site said that Moscow allegedly wanted to keep silent about their plans. Recall that in October, Russia completed deliveries of S-300 to Syria. SAM Syria received after repair and free of charge. At the same time, the Ministry of Defense stated that the training of Syrian specialists would require three months.
Israel and the United States have repeatedly blamed Russia because of the supply of S-300 to Syria. So these countries are trying to justify their possible attacks on the complexes delivered to Syria.
